If the diameter of a capillary is doubled, then the rise of water in it will be – |
| A. | two times |
| B. | half |
| C. | four times |
| D. | no change |
| Answer» B. half | |
|
Explanation: Radius of a capillary tube is inversely proportional to the height of the liquid |
